Who Is Alison Hammond?
Alison Hammond is one of the UK’s best-known television presenters. After first appearing on Big Brother, she built an impressive broadcasting career, becoming a familiar face on programmes including This Morning and other entertainment shows.

Healthy Lifestyle Habits Beyond Diet
Weight management involves much more than food and exercise.
Better Sleep
Quality sleep helps regulate hormones involved in:
- Hunger
- Appetite
- Recovery
- Energy
Adults generally benefit from around seven to nine hours of sleep each night.

Common Myths About Celebrity Weight Loss
Myth 1: Celebrities Lose Weight Instantly
Reality:
Most transformations occur gradually through consistent habits.
Myth 2: One Diet Works for Everyone
Reality:
Each person’s nutritional needs differ.
Myth 3: Exercise Alone Causes Weight Loss
Reality:
Nutrition, sleep, activity, stress, and consistency all play important roles.
Myth 4: Thin Always Means Healthy
Reality:
Health cannot be judged solely by body size.
